diff options
author | Dmitriy <43755002+psydvl@users.noreply.github.com> | 2022-03-28 21:59:12 +0300 |
---|---|---|
committer | Dmitriy <43755002+psydvl@users.noreply.github.com> | 2022-06-29 00:41:32 +0300 |
commit | 40674f0d7f6b06f0b96a6b24cb8d31363a92da86 (patch) | |
tree | 5f13ff799272b861a7c76b4c693bf94309c0e661 /pkgs/os-specific/linux/kernel/linux-zen.nix | |
parent | 09143afa61a477cb77be43ad3e98284adec39cc0 (diff) | |
download | nixpkgs-40674f0d7f6b06f0b96a6b24cb8d31363a92da86.tar nixpkgs-40674f0d7f6b06f0b96a6b24cb8d31363a92da86.tar.gz nixpkgs-40674f0d7f6b06f0b96a6b24cb8d31363a92da86.tar.bz2 nixpkgs-40674f0d7f6b06f0b96a6b24cb8d31363a92da86.tar.lz nixpkgs-40674f0d7f6b06f0b96a6b24cb8d31363a92da86.tar.xz nixpkgs-40674f0d7f6b06f0b96a6b24cb8d31363a92da86.tar.zst nixpkgs-40674f0d7f6b06f0b96a6b24cb8d31363a92da86.zip |
linux_lqx, linux_zen: refactor to unify
Unify linux_zen and linux_lqx -> zen-kernels
Diffstat (limited to 'pkgs/os-specific/linux/kernel/linux-zen.nix')
-rw-r--r-- | pkgs/os-specific/linux/kernel/linux-zen.nix | 39 |
1 files changed, 0 insertions, 39 deletions
diff --git a/pkgs/os-specific/linux/kernel/linux-zen.nix b/pkgs/os-specific/linux/kernel/linux-zen.nix deleted file mode 100644 index 504cb126742..00000000000 --- a/pkgs/os-specific/linux/kernel/linux-zen.nix +++ /dev/null @@ -1,39 +0,0 @@ -{ lib, fetchFromGitHub, buildLinux, ... } @ args: - -let - # having the full version string here makes it easier to update - modDirVersion = "5.18.5-zen1"; - parts = lib.splitString "-" modDirVersion; - version = lib.elemAt parts 0; - suffix = lib.elemAt parts 1; - - numbers = lib.splitString "." version; - branch = "${lib.elemAt numbers 0}.${lib.elemAt numbers 1}"; - rev = if ((lib.elemAt numbers 2) == "0") then "v${branch}-${suffix}" else "v${modDirVersion}"; -in - -buildLinux (args // { - inherit version modDirVersion; - isZen = true; - - src = fetchFromGitHub { - owner = "zen-kernel"; - repo = "zen-kernel"; - inherit rev; - sha256 = "sha256-q6a8Wyzs6GNQ39mV+q/9N6yo/kXS9ZH+QTfGka42gk4="; - }; - - structuredExtraConfig = with lib.kernel; { - ZEN_INTERACTIVE = yes; - # TODO: Remove once #175433 reaches master - # https://nixpk.gs/pr-tracker.html?pr=175433 - WERROR = no; - }; - - extraMeta = { - inherit branch; - maintainers = with lib.maintainers; [ atemu andresilva ]; - description = "Built using the best configuration and kernel sources for desktop, multimedia, and gaming workloads."; - }; - -} // (args.argsOverride or { })) |